The Kazakhstan IoT Connectivity Market was estimated at USD 285 Million in 2025 and is projected to reach USD 390 Million by 2032, growing at a CAGR of 5.2% from 2026 to 2032.
The Kazakhstan IoT connectivity market is currently on an upward trajectory, driven by the rapid adoption of advanced wireless technologies and the ongoing rollout of 5G networks. Companies across various sectors are increasingly prioritizing reliable connectivity to facilitate real-time data exchange, which is essential for their operational efficiency.
Looking ahead, the market is expected to continue its growth, bolstered by an expanding number of connected devices and advancements in network infrastructure. However, challenges remain, particularly in rural regions where connectivity is still lacking, posing potential roadblocks to widespread IoT implementation.

Despite the promising outlook, the Kazakhstan IoT connectivity market faces substantial restraints. One major issue is the uneven distribution of network infrastructure. Urban centers are generally well-equipped, while rural and remote areas struggle with inadequate internet access, limiting IoT deployment in those regions. on top of that, concerns regarding data privacy and security significantly hinder adoption rates, as businesses demand robust regulatory frameworks and cybersecurity measures to safeguard sensitive information.
Several trends are shaping the Kazakhstan IoT connectivity market. The rise of smart agriculture is notable, as farmers utilize IoT technologies to optimize crop yields and reduce resource waste. Similarly, smart transportation initiatives are gaining traction, facilitating better traffic management and logistics. On the technology front, the integration of artificial intelligence with IoT is becoming increasingly popular, providing businesses with advanced analytics capabilities to enhance decision-making.
The market presents numerous growth opportunities, particularly in sectors such as healthcare, where IoT applications can enhance patient monitoring and management. Additionally, the ongoing development of smart city initiatives offers a fertile ground for investment in connectivity solutions. Companies looking to penetrate the rural market can explore innovative partnerships with local governments or tech providers to expand their reach and infrastructure capabilities.
Government initiatives are crucial in shaping the future of the IoT connectivity market in Kazakhstan. Policies focus on expanding broadband infrastructure and promoting innovative technologies that support IoT adoption. The regulatory environment is becoming increasingly favorable as authorities work to address connectivity gaps, particularly in underserved areas.
Looking ahead to 2026-2032, the Kazakhstan IoT connectivity market is expected to experience continued growth, driven by technological advancements and increased investment from both the public and private sectors. The push for smart city developments will likely accelerate demand for IoT solutions, creating opportunities for innovation and collaboration among stakeholders. As infrastructure improvements take shape, we anticipate a gradual narrowing of the connectivity gap between urban and rural areas, further propelling market expansion.
